Stewed tomatoes are a versatile pantry staple with endless possibilities. They can be enjoyed on their own, used in soups, stews, sauces, and even as a base for chili. The key to making delicious stewed tomatoes lies in the right combination of ingredients and a careful processing method.

Preparation:

Start by selecting ripe, blemish-free tomatoes. Wash them thoroughly, then blanch them for a few minutes to loosen their skins. Once cooled, peel the tomatoes and remove any cores. Chop the tomatoes into desired sizes – smaller pieces for a smoother texture, larger chunks for a more rustic feel.

Flavoring:

Flavoring options are endless, but here are some classics:

  • Simple: Salt, pepper, and a pinch of sugar.
  • Herby: Fresh or dried herbs like basil, oregano, thyme, or parsley.
  • Spicy: Garlic, onion, red pepper flakes, or chili powder.

Stewing & Canning:

  1. Stew the tomatoes: Combine the prepared tomatoes with your chosen flavorings in a large pot. Bring to a simmer and cook for 30-45 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the tomatoes are soft and have reduced slightly.
  2. Fill the jars: While the tomatoes are still hot, ladle them into clean, sterilized jars, leaving a 1/2-inch headspace.
  3. Process: Wipe the jar rims with a clean, damp cloth to remove any residue. Secure the lids tightly and place the jars in a boiling water bath for the recommended time (consult your canning guide for specific processing times based on your altitude).

Storage:

Once the jars are fully cooled, check for a good seal by pressing down on the center of the lid. If it doesn't flex, the seal is secure. Store the jars in a cool, dark, and dry place for up to 12 months.
